Output 5ad070e5961f001f633510926f9b312ac93c1fe3fbd1b7d70f30aba3e1f7f093:1

value
542999032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10a73c597509e2b1d23cfa5c8a76eafbb87e38eb OP_EQUAL
address
33D55MbiX8ZKFtY8pCi5YKAES5RknqNHf5
transaction
5ad070e5961f001f633510926f9b312ac93c1fe3fbd1b7d70f30aba3e1f7f093
spent
true